Small Master Bathroom Ideas With Walk In Shower
When it comes to bathroom design, space efficiency is key, especially in smaller spaces like master bathrooms. Incorporating a walk-in shower can be a brilliant solution to maximize both functionality and style in compact settings. Here are some inspiring ideas to help you create a small master bathroom with a walk-in shower that feels both luxurious and spacious:
1. Embrace Neutral Colors:
Light, neutral colors like white, beige, or gray create an illusion of space and make the bathroom feel more airy. Stick to a cohesive color scheme to enhance visual flow and avoid making the room feel cluttered.
2. Maximize Vertical Space:
Utilize the vertical space by installing shelves, cabinets, or wall-mounted storage units. These provide ample storage without taking up valuable floor space. Consider recessed niches in the shower walls for added functionality and a sleek look.
3. Opt for a Frameless Shower Enclosure:
Frameless shower enclosures eliminate bulky frames, creating a more open and spacious feel. They allow for uninterrupted sightlines, making the bathroom appear larger.
4. Use Multifunctional Fixtures:
Incorporate multifunctional fixtures to save space and enhance convenience. For example, a vanity with built-in storage drawers or a toilet with an integrated bidet can streamline the bathroom design while providing essential functionality.
5. Add Mirrors and Natural Light:
Mirrors reflect light and make the bathroom feel more expansive. Place large mirrors opposite the shower or windows to create a sense of depth. Maximize natural light by strategically placing windows or installing skylights to brighten up the space.
6. Keep the Shower Area Clean and Organized:
Clutter can make a small bathroom feel cramped and disorganized. Maintain a clean and organized shower area by using storage baskets, shelves, or caddies to keep toiletries and essentials within easy reach.
7. Incorporate Textured Elements:
Subtle textures can add visual interest and depth to a small bathroom. Consider using textured tiles, stone accents, or patterned wallpaper to create a sophisticated and inviting ambiance.
8. Install a Rain Showerhead:
A rain showerhead can create a spa-like experience in even the smallest of bathrooms. Its wide, gentle spray envelops the body, providing a relaxing and rejuvenating shower experience.
9. Use Bold Patterns and Statement Pieces:
In small bathrooms, don't be afraid to experiment with bold patterns or eye-catching statement pieces. A patterned tile floor or a unique vanity can add character and personality while still maintaining a cohesive design scheme.
With careful planning and attention to detail, you can create a small master bathroom with a walk-in shower that is both functional and stylish. Embrace space-saving ideas, utilize vertical space, and incorporate design elements that enhance the sense of spaciousness. These ideas will help you achieve a luxurious and inviting bathroom experience, even in a compact setting.
